We’re all waiting with baited breath to see what Martin Scorsese’s next fictional film will be, after the unanimous success that was THE DEPARTED, and I use the word ‘fictional’ because Scorsese has announced that he’ll be making a documentary about the late Beatle George Harrison.

Harrison died in 2001 (I can’t believe it’s been that long) and Variey is reporting that Scorsese will team with Harrison’s family to produce a comprehensive story about the rock legend’s life, including his career as a Beatle, his successful solo efforts, his life as a movie mogul (he produced MONTY PYTHON’S LIFE OF BRIAN and TIME BANDITS) and his quest for spirituality, which has taken on legendary status. Surviving Beatles member Paul McCartney and Ringo Starr are expected to participate. I fully expect this film to continue in the tradition of Scorsese’s other great rock documentatres, THE LAST WALTZ and NO DIRECTION HOME. And unlike the latter Bob Dylan documentary, this one is expected to have a theatrical release.
